Commercial Finance Lead

Location: Hybrid (2 days a week in the London or Milton Keynes Office)

Employment Type: Permanent

As the UK’s favourite property platform, Rightmove aims to give everyone the belief that they can make their move. To help us achieve this, we’re looking for a Commercial Finance Lead to join our Commercial Finance team.

Are you ready to take the lead in driving revenue for one of Rightmove’s most exciting business units? In this role, you’ll be working alongside P&L owners across our Estate Agency business unit, playing a key part in shaping and executing our revenue strategy.

You’ll have the freedom to take ownership of revenue initiatives from start to finish – whether it’s designing new business opportunities or managing day‑to‑day operations. If you love being hands‑on, solving problems, and bringing people together, this could be the perfect role for you.

What you’ll be doing
  • Owning Revenue Objectives: You’ll be responsible for ensuring we meet our targets, analysing data, managing operations, or developing future strategies.
  • Collaborating with Sales: Partner with the Sales team to manage ongoing operations and execute necessary changes to keep us on track.
  • Tracking Success: Contribute to annual and quarterly revenue planning, building scenarios and financial models to measure and guide our progress.
  • Leading Strategic Projects: From concept to completion, you’ll drive key projects that help grow revenue.
  • Building Relationships: You’ll collaborate with leaders across Sales, Marketing, Customer Experience, Finance, Product, and more to achieve our goals together.
Who you are
  • Experienced Professional: Proven experience in Commercial Finance, Operations, Analytics, Pricing, or Revenue Management, ready to take on new challenges and drive impact.
  • Strategic Problem Solver: Strong background in strategy development, project management, and data analysis, with a proven track record of taking projects from concept to completion.
  • Effective Communicator: Skilled at simplifying complex ideas and presenting them clearly to senior leadership, with the ability to build consensus across teams.
  • Data Expert: Proficient in working with large datasets, advanced Excel skills, and the ability to turn data into actionable insights that drive business decisions.
  • PowerPoint and Excel Pro: Capable of creating clear, impactful presentations that simplify complex information for any audience and building relevant models to justify decisions.
  • Project Manager: Experienced in juggling multiple priorities, delivering on time, and ensuring cross‑functional teams work together seamlessly.
  • Detail‑Oriented: Attentive to every aspect of your role, from customer‑facing tasks to internal operations, ensuring nothing falls through the cracks.
  • Emotionally Intelligent: A natural collaborator, you build strong relationships with different teams and adapt well to a fast‑paced, dynamic environment.
  • Action‑Oriented: You take ownership of your work, tackle challenges head‑on, and consistently drive meaningful results.
About the team

This role sits within our high‑performing Commercial Finance team, reporting to the Estate Agency Revenue Manager. We’re a dynamic and ambitious team, constantly looking for ways to innovate and grow. You’ll have plenty of opportunities to take ownership, make an impact, and grow alongside us.
